Over a lengthy period, Jonathan Hickman has significantly impacted the storyline of Marvel’s X-Men. Starting from 2019 up until earlier this year, he was instrumental in launching the Krakoan Age, a major overhaul of the mutant status quo by Marvel Comics. Although Hickman parted ways with the series in 2022, allowing other creators to guide the narrative towards its conclusion, he has just revisited the concept in an unforeseen manner.

Title hinting at the content, “Aliens vs. Avengers” #1, tells a tale of conflict between the Marvel Universe’s valiant heroes and the terrifying extraterrestrials from the Alien series. Instead of leaping forward in time to follow an eclectic group of aging heroes attempting to save Earth, this issue illustrates the collapse of numerous regions on Earth as depicted by Marvel’s map. Notably, the island of Krakoa serves as a backdrop, where, according to Hickman’s narrative, most X-Men have utilized portals to escape to their Martian colony. In stark contrast, Apocalypse elects to remain behind and battle the encroaching Xenomorphs.

Why Did Jonathan Hickman Leave X-Men?

When Hickman revealed his decision to leave not only the primary X-Men series but also his role in managing the wider Krakoa project, he mentioned shifting creative objectives as one of the factors behind his departure.

Initially, Hickman had a grand vision for the X-Men story he wanted to tell, divided into three major acts. The first part of this plan was House of X, but as things turned out, the entire scheme underwent significant changes. He explained this to Entertainment Weekly, mentioning that the initial plan, although it could be stretched over three years, was not definitive due to numerous intriguing ideas he had planted that other creators might want to explore. This lack of specificity and the desire for collaboration with other writers led to an open-ended approach, and Hickman made it clear to Marvel from the start that he couldn’t predict how long the first part would last.

What Is Aliens vs. Avengers About?

In the first issue of “Aliens vs. Avengers“, the events culminate with Xenomorphs invading Earth. The ultimate organism faces a planet filled with superhumans. “Throughout my tenure at Marvel, I’ve exclusively worked on licensed or superhero properties. When this unique opportunity presented itself about two years ago, I couldn’t resist. As a huge fan of the ‘Aliens’ universe and its rich mythology, I found it challenging yet exciting to blend these elements with Marvel’s style,” Hickman explained to Entertainment Weekly upon announcing the project. “Esad and I have managed to create a fusion that caters to fans of both franchises.”
